Six introductory workshops about Aymara's millenary culture. Facilitated by Yatichiri Eva Mamañi Challapa and organized by Rodrigo Barreda.
About this Event

This series of six workshops provide a basic understanding of Aymara worldview and philosphy to students and the general public. Our goal us to introduce participants to a re-acknowledgement of the Aymara people, so that they may be able to identify its culture, languagem ways of life and territory, while helping safeguard the survivial of this millenary culture.

The workshops have been designed and are delivered by Eva Mamañi Challapa, Yatichiri of the Aymara communitites of Panavinto and Alto Hospicio in the region of Tarapacá, Chile.

WORKSHOP SCHEDULE

  1. Saturday, March 7 The Aymara People and Language
  2. Saturday, March 14 Aymara Territories
  3. Saturday, March 21 Values and Principles of the Aymara
  4. Saturday, March 28 Andean Worldview
  5. Saturday, April 4 Worldview Activities
  6. Saturday, April 11 Andean Textile Art Thought


FORMAT

  • Hybrid, in-person/online.
  • Classes will be delivered online to students who will be gathered in person. Meetings will take place at: Sur Gallery, 39 Queens Quay East, Suite 100, Toronto.
  • Workshops will be delivered in Castellano (Spanish) with live translation to English.


COST FOR THE SIX WORKSHOPS

General Admission $40.00 CAD

Student $25.00 CAD (valid student ID will be required in person)


This series is organized by Rodrigo Barreda in partnership with Sur Gallery.
